Secrets hidden underground (1)

A day like any other day.

Roman Dmitry, who was immersed in training alone, received a report from Hans that he had found something underground in an iron mine.

'Is there an artificial passageway? It is practically impossible.'

Iron Mine Underground.

Drilling a tunnel is artificially securing a path.

It made no sense to create an artificially made passage under the ground, which was made of clay and stones, into a shape suitable for the work.

Think about it. It is a space that does not allow human access in the first place.

How the hell did you make an underground passage, and what is its purpose?

perhaps.

There was a possibility of a dungeon.

According to historical sayings, archmage builds their own nests in spaces that are physically inaccessible.

Arrived at the iron mine.

It was a place where I had to climb a few mountains, and as I followed Morkan's guide, I saw a huge hole.

"Here it is."

passage down to the basement.

It was definitely artificial.

After moving along it for a while, a scene that put an end to the fact that a human was touched unfolded before my eyes.

"I also saw this and you don't know how embarrassed I was. When I first surveyed the ground for the tunnel work, I obviously didn't find that there was such a space underground. However, as the tunnel was drilled, an empty space formed a void, which caused a collapse event. Who the hell made this in the basement?"

huge door.

At the end of the passage, a steel gate blocked the way.

It wasn't just plain steel, but steel with a pattern engraved on it, and the existence of the door proved that it was possible to enter and exit through this place.

For Roman Dmitry, it wasn't a matter to be overlooked.

The Endless Mountains were strategically important to Dmitry, and he needed to be sure of this place.

"Call Felix."

Okay.

It can create an aura and cut through steel.

However, in preparation for the possibility of a magical trap, I tried to open the door through Felix.

some time later

Felix has arrived.

Felix immediately looked at the door, and quickly made a decision.

"The entire steel door is imbued with magical energy. If you try to force the door open, it's likely that the mana exploded and the underground passage collapsed. For now, I'll use my mana to get rid of the explosion.

It was the beginning of tedious work.

3 days thereafter.

Felix clings to the steel door and carefully drains the mana.

It was such a sophisticated job that I couldn't even dare to do it with any skill, and I was drenched in sweat while working as Felix.

When three days passed like that. In front of Roman Dmitry watching, Felix finally succeeded in opening the gate.

" The door is open!"


evil.

Mana swirled.

People's attention was focused on the energy of mana spreading through the entire steel door.

squeaky.

The door opened.

That was then.

As Felix was about to check beyond the door with anticipation, a wretched hand grabbed the back of his back and threw it against the wall.

The feeling of embarrassment was brief.

When Felix raised his head to see who had thrown him, Roman Dmitry jumped forward and blocked the space where Felix was.

OK.

Papa Papak-

Dozens of arrows hit Roman Dmitry as it was.

* * *

beyond the door.

The presence of arrows was captured by a sensitive sense.

Roman Dmitry reacted quickly, sending Felix back and forming a shield to block all arrows.

Tata Tak.

The arrow fell to the floor.

Felix, with a bewildered face, understood the situation and said in a trembling voice.

"It seems to be a dungeon with traps installed."

just now.

Felix didn't respond.

The arrow attack was threatening enough to overwhelm the magician's senses, which meant that this place would not allow human footsteps.

It was an ironic situation.

A trap that fires arrows as soon as the door is opened and mana containing the energy of an explosion while recognizing the fact that it is a passage due to the existence of a steel door.

Roman Dmitry said.

"I will check the inside from now on."

"Dangerous! There may be some traps lurking in the dungeon. Even if it takes a little bit of time, I think it would be good to fully understand the existence of the trap."

no. If there are living things living here, there is a high probability that they are aware of our existence the moment the door opens. The longer we delay, the greater the risk we have to bear. You wait here."

moved a step

He made a decision, and everyone admitted that it was best, even if it was risky.

widely.

I stepped through the door.

I expanded my senses and prepared for any unexpected variables.

only ten steps.

Shortly thereafter, the wall cracked and a weapon equipped with an arrow appeared.

Papa Papak.

It was a surprise attack.

Hundreds of arrows were fired from all directions, but Roman Dmitry raised a sword this time to block the attack.

That's when the trap started.

Arrows were fired by surprise with every step they took, and in some places the ground suddenly fell, revealing sharp spears from within.

And.

' dock?'

A strong gas was sprayed.

It was a very lethal type of poison for ordinary people, but Roman Dmitry immediately detoxified it by generating mana as soon as he inhaled it.

Roman Dmitry, who experienced the poison of the Four Heavenly Gates.

The beings who formed the underground space made a lot of preparations, but none of the traps worked because they met the wrong person.

This made sure

The owner of this place contradictedly did not allow other people to walk even though he made the passage.

'This is how the trachea of the Zhuge Sega (諸葛世家) was.'

Five generations of political parties.

If the Four Heavenly Gates were troubled by poison, Zhuge Sega drove the demons into a corner with his brilliant head and an engine-type that set up traps in advance.

Even then, Baek Jung-hyuk's force thwarted the opponent's plan.

The Zhugesse were recognized geniuses, but there was no way they could handle the force beyond their plans.

finally.

In order for the trap to succeed, there must be at least one word of opportunity.

Roman Dmitry did not allow such a room, and in an instant, broke through all the traps in the underground space.

Finally the end was in sight.

At the end of the road, there was a space leading to the inside, and suddenly a human voice was heard from there.

"Stop!"

A loud, angry voice.

It was as expected.

Underneath the endless mountain range, life lived.

* * *

said the owner of the voice.

"This is our land. If you get any closer, I'm sure you won't be able to guarantee your life.

shrill voice.

The unknown was infested with hostility.

If it were a normal situation.

Roman Dmitry would have had room for compromise, but the fact that this was an endless mountain range was a problem.

"I am Roman Dmitry of the Dmitry family. The Endless Mountains are Dmitry's realm, and we discovered an underground passage while developing an iron mine. Reveal your identity and reveal your identity. If this is not explained, I cannot stand by as a threat to Dmitry."

Endless mountains.

It was Dmitry's safety net.

It did not allow any foreign invasion, and Roman Dmitry formed a last bastion for Dmitry in the endless mountains.

After starting to create an environment like Mt. Hundreds.

Farming using the plains of the mountains has developed, and if time passes, Dmitry will be able to become self-sufficient.

By the way.

If there were creatures unrelated to Dmitry in the endless mountains.

Unpredictable variables have overshadowed the meaning of the last bastion.

dog sound! We have no reason to explain to you!"

"It is not for you to decide. On the continent, the endless mountain range was declared the land of Cairo, and Dmitry inherited that right. I am not trying to negotiate with you. Should I get rid of the beings that formed their home in Dmitry's land, or should I grant you your right to live? thinking about it If you stick with the attitude you have now, the situation will not improve."

Shh.

drew his sword

beyond space.

I heard the sound of rushing movements.

However, their form in contact with mana was a little different from the normal human form.

That was then.

"Damn you morons. Do not impose on us the laws of men!"

with an angry voice.

The owner of the voice appeared in front of me.

* * *

short height.

different body.

bushy beard.

Their physical characteristics pointed to one being.

' Dwarf?'

It was certain.

They were of different races.

It is a race of artisans who are said to have received the blessing of the anvil, and had physical conditions similar to those of humans, but they were completely different from humans.

In fact, this race is not a mythical being.

Although it is not common, it exists on the continent, and there are sayings that dark elves can be heard in the southern jungle, and the siren's voice can be heard across the sea and on unnamed islands.

And sometimes.

Slaves of different races appeared in the slave market.

They call it a price, and in the case of Dwarves, they are usually sold to a blacksmith.

said the dwarf.

"It does not matter to us how humans divided borders. We have been settled here underground since long ago, and it is a fact that no one can deny. Did I say Roman Dmitry? I have lived two hundred and eighty years this year. Even when I was born on this land and received blessings from my people, humans never showed up here, but for what reason do you claim this place as yours!"

His voice was full of hostility.

heterogeneous.

They hated humans.

In the old days, there were records that they lived in harmony with humans, but the greed of some people who used different races as slaves led to the ruin of the relationship.

To this day, the feelings that have been passed down from generation to generation are deeply ingrained in my bones.

For the sole reason of being a human, the Dwarf could not accept the existence of Roman Dmitry.

'I'm trembling.'

Drift's hand.

The large hand holding the axe was trembling very slightly.

they saw too

As they completely destroyed the trap, they recognized the fact that they were an enemy that they could not handle with their own strength.

nevertheless.

She exposed her face and raised her voice.

If they didn't do that, they thought they couldn't guarantee their lives.

'A heterogeneous race that exists in the endless mountain range. How did you deal with them?'

this problem.

The division of race was not an important issue.

Roman Dmitry was worried about the fact that they exist in the endless mountain range, regardless of the fact that the opponent was a dwarf.

As they say, ownership of the endless mountain range may be a one-sided claim by humans.

But if there was anything they put Dmitry in danger, the words they said didn't matter in the least.

Eliminating risk factors.

It was the commander's job.

Roman Dmitry was willing to be cruel if necessary.

"Like you said, this may not be Dmitry, but your land. But what I need is the assurance that your existence is not a threat to Dmitry. The endless mountain range touches the ground with Dmitry. It means that just as we have set foot on your land, you are also close enough to set foot on ours at any time. So convince me The reason I don't have to be hostile to you, the conviction that coexistence with you is safe. Otherwise, we have no choice but to make a decision."

It was a complicated matter.

Unlike Kronos, who wanted to conquer the continent, Dmitry and the Dwarves depended on each other's survival.

if you just pass by.

Can we ignore each other's existence like before?

It was impossible.

The existence of the dwarves will be known through the miners of the iron mine, and each other's existence will inevitably touch nerves.

From then on, the strife sprouts.

Roman Dmitry reigned as a heavenly demon and had seen countless times how small strife grew, so he hoped to clear up his relationship with the Dwarf in the first place.

As if part of the endless mountain range was their land.

Another part was also certain to be Dmitry's land.

Dmitry's history proved him, and this matter had nothing to do with racial divisions.

"Are you sure? How the hell did we convince you!"

The Dwarf was bewildered.

He did not wish for war, but neither did he readily come up with the answer Roman Dmitry wanted.

That was then.

The Dwarf, who was rolling his eyes with a bewildered face, suddenly saw Roman Dmitry's sword.

Moment.

His eyes were dimly colored.

Even though he knew he shouldn't be doing this in an instant, he was completely absorbed in the sword's appearance.

" Could you take a look at that sword?"

that's.

It was a really absurd question that didn't fit the situation.
